The Housing Partnership Network’s results-oriented business model has sparked the formation of innovative social enterprises that enhance the performance of the housing sector. From creative lending programs and insurance to homeownership counseling and neighborhood stabilization, these entrepreneurial businesses increase member productivity, scale and ability to respond to the needs of the communities in which they work.
The Network has also helped launch four independent companies, including two which have been spun off – the Gulf Coast Housing Partnership and the National Community Stabilization Trust. Each demonstrates the power of our partnership model to forge bold and effective responses to national crises.
